Immerse yourself in the intricate and virtuoso world of Leopold Godowsky with "Godowsky, L.: Piano Music, Vol. 3." Released on October 2, 1998, under the Marco-Polo label, this classical piano album is a testament to Godowsky's extraordinary skill and innovation. The album spans a rich duration of 1 hour and 11 minutes, featuring a collection of pieces from various composers, including Lully, Rameau, Corelli, Schobert, Loeillet, Dandrieu, and Scarlatti.
Godowsky, known for his legendary Studies on Chopin's Études, showcases his mastery of the piano in this volume.
